Public transport, Rivertown-style

I have to say I have rather a lot against places like the rivertown Tong-Li, where I was today.

The Chinese have an almost unrivalled capacity for taking something that is intrinsically beautiful and interesting and turning it into a meretricious tourist experience full of identikit tourist tat and driving out all that made it worth seeing in the first place.

In fact I would have wholly regretted coming to Tong-Li if it weren't for the very beautiful vistas down canalside footways, the astonishingly pragmatic and thorough Sex Museum (the history of sex section started with the sex lives of dinosaurs, believe it or not) and these wonderfully designed and painted tricycle rickshaws which must be survivals from the twenties at the latest and are still the main form of transport.

I also like the way the driver is perched on it, resting his calf muscles, whilst waiting for his next customer
